While each of our patients presents a unique situation and course of action, we follow the same general treatment plan
Implant surgery – we extract any remaining teeth and, while you are comfortably sedated, place dental implants using surgical guides we custom made beforehand. Once the implants are stable, we attach a temporary, which is either a prototype or a denture conversion.
Read MoreHealing time – dental implants require 3-4 months to fully heal and integrate with your existing jaw bone. During this time, you will be in a stable temporary that will provide adequate function so you can continue to eat, speak, and laugh comfortably.
Read MoreFinal prosthesis – when the dental implants have fully healed, we take impressions of your mouth and verify correction with a specialized verification jig. We use this information to create a wax try-in that you can wear, allowing us to perfect the aesthetic look using our digital software. Depending on your case, we custom design your final prosthesis from strong, aesthetic zirconia or PMMA material.
